Output 1153752d832d09bb6110ac9ab78b8ca3cd47d79cd9385f97c040643331c9070e:1

value
9155333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4ccda768a966a1a631f86362cf282e726a4e65 OP_EQUAL
address
371H84PXMHEdGGhKtABx5vGJEFrkFKoeyy
transaction
1153752d832d09bb6110ac9ab78b8ca3cd47d79cd9385f97c040643331c9070e
confirmations
284853
spent
true